The Evolution of Slot Mechanics

Modern video slots have moved far beyond the simple three-reel, single-payline machines of the past. Today’s titles incorporate a dizzying array of mechanics designed to keep gameplay fresh and engaging. One of the most influential innovations has been the Megaways engine, originally developed by Big Time Gaming. This mechanic randomly changes the number of symbols appearing on each reel during every spin, resulting in thousands of potential ways to win—sometimes up to 117,649 or sir thomas more. Games like Bonanza and Extra Chilli popularised this initialise, and it has since been licensed by numerous studios. The appeal lies in the unpredictability: no two spins feel the same, and the sheer volume of paylines can lead to explosive winning combinations. Another major trend is the Hold & Win mechanic, often found in games by Light & Wonder. In these slots, landing a special bonus symbol triggers a respin feature where other symbols lock in place, and only if new bonus symbols appear. Each new single resets the respin counter, offering the potential to fill the entire grid for a jackpot prize. This simple yet addictive loop-the-loop has made games like Dragon Link and Dollar Storm recurrent favourites in both land-based and online casinos. Cluster Pays mechanics, popularised by NetEnt’s Aloha! Cluster Pays, supply another departure from traditional paylines. Instead of matching symbols on fixed lines, wins are awarded for clusters of adjacent symbols, often with cascading or tumbling reels. This means winning symbols go away and new ones fall into place, potentially creating chain reactions of wins from a single spin. The combination of cluster pays with cascading symbols creates a dynamic, fast-paced experience that can yield substantial multipliers as the wins cumulate. These core mechanics have become staples in the industry, forming the foundation for numberless innovative slot titles.

Bonus Buy and Volatility Considerations

The introduction of the Bonus Buy feature has been a game-changer for players who prefer direct enter to a slot’s bonus round. Instead of waiting for scatter symbols to trigger free spins or other features organically, players can pay a fixed multiple of their bet—often 50x to 100x—to instantly go into the bonus game. This mechanic is particularly popular in high-volatility slots where the base of operations game can be relatively uneventful but the bonus rounds offer massive win potency. Games like Sweet Bonanza and Gates of Olympus have embraced this feature, allowing players to skip the mash and go straight to the action. However, it’s important for players to understand that Bonus Buy options typically come with higher volatility, meaning the cost can be significant and wins are not guaranteed. Some jurisdictions, including the UK, have regulations around the visibleness and promotion of Bonus Buy features, so players should always check the terms. Expanding reels correspond another engaging mechanic, often tied to bonus rounds or progressive features. In these slots, the reel grid expands during certain phases, adding special rows or columns to increase winning possibilities. For instance, some games start with a standard 5×3 grid but expand to 5×6 or sir thomas more during free spins, dramatically boosting the number of ways to win. This visual enlargement adds excitement and can take to significantly larger payouts. The interplay between volatility, RTP, and these mechanics is crucial: a high-volatility slot with expanding reels and a Bonus Buy choice mightiness offer life-changing jackpots but also carries higher risk of exposure. Players should always review the game’s RTP and volatility rating before committing real cash, especially when using features like Bonus Buy that increase the cost per spin.

Cascading Reels and Multipliers

Cascading reels, also known as tumbling or avalanche reels, have become a hallmark of modern slot design. Instead of spinning reels stopping with winning combinations highlighted, the winning symbols burst or disappear, and fresh symbols strike from higher up to fill the gaps. This allows for consecutive wins from a single spin, often with increasing multipliers applied to each cascade. The mechanic is nucleus to many favoured titles, including the Megaways series and games like Reactoonz. The multiplier aspect is particularly compelling: some slots get going with a 1x multiplier on the first win, increasing by 1x with each subsequent cascade, while others apply random multipliers to item-by-item winning clusters. This can lead to exponential ontogenesis in payouts during a single spin. For example, in a game like Jammin’ Jars, each cascade increases the multiplier up to a maximum, turning a modest starting win into a substantial pay back. The combination of cascading reels and multipliers creates a sense of momentum and expectancy, as each win fuels the potential for an yet bigger single. Some slots also incorporate progressive multipliers that persist throughout the entire bonus round, resetting only when the feature ends. This mechanic is particularly good in high-volatility games where the base game may be quiet but the bonus rounds can produce massive wins. Additionally, the visual feedback of symbols exploding and new ones dropping keeps the player intermeshed, making each spin finger like a mini-event. For UK players, discernment how cascading reels and multipliers interact is key to choosing games that match their risk tolerance and play style.
